Just thought I'd share some pics I took of Belle yesterday, outside. I just wheeled his whole cage out there for a good cleaning, but not before he got to make the major mess in it.

Belle was a feral pigeon that was injured and couldn't fly and could barely walk. I couldn't leave him in that parking lot to die...so I brought him home.

A pigeon forum told me I had rescued a young pigeon because he only made squeaking sounds. And couldn't tell the sex. Well, I thought I had a female, so I named her Belle...but it's very evident now that he's older...he's absolutely a Male. Still his name is Belle :D

After a few weeks, he decided that the cush indoor life was much more his style. We bonded, he tamed down a lot and when we went to release him, he refused to go...he just curled up in a ball and rolled back into my husbands hands when he tried to perch him up on a totem in our front yard! Funniest thing I'd seen!

Sooo...we have no guilty feelings of keeping him domesticated. He loves it!

Usually I bring Belle outside in a flight suit, but yesterday was soo pretty I thought he'd enjoy just hanging out in his cage outside.

First order of business...he showed me he wanted a bath by dunking his head in his water dish, so I got his favorite "tub" and filled it with water.

He does this funniest thing too, I tried to get a picture of it...he tries to lay in the water on his side and he stretches his opposite wing straight up in the air...like a sail! LOL! Then he flops on his other side and does the same thing. He's such a goofey bird.

I didn't know a pigeon would be soo much fun. He's so amazingly smart. He's terribly spoiled and loves it. He coo's all the time and he even plays with his toys I have hanging in there. He coos and struts and dances all the time. His cage set up is perfect for him, because he can hover fly to exercise himself without hitting anything.

When loose in the house (which is almost every day), he follows me around, hanging out on my shoulder or head while I do the dishes...on top of the fridge while I cook, he rides on the head rest in the car when I take him bye bye with me...which he's decided car rides are definitely his favorite mode of transportation.

Belle has rewarded me every day since I rescued him. I'm so glad I did, otherwise I'd have never known how truly amazing pigeons are and what wonderful pets they really do make.

Thanks Ann :D

Unfortunately he doesn't try to be friends with the others. He just wants to jump on them and attack. :mad:

However, it's probably NOT Belle's fault...entirely...that he acts this way, because my little bully bird Franklin..our conure...well he thinks he's tough stuff and would take on a lion without a second thought. He's definitely small but mighty!

So one day, we had everyone out, including Belle, they were all foraging and playing with toys and each was minding their own business...when Franklin decided he didn't like Belle anymore and ran up to him and attacked...Belle immediately took defence and before anyone was hurt we got them separated. PHEW!

After that, Belle has kept the defense stand with the others and will jump on top of any of them and start to peck. So we only let him out by himself now.

Franklin has learned to "beee niiice" and no longer tries to attack the others when out for play time...but Belle can't seem to let that chip fall..

It was pretty traumatizing for Belle to know that that little "hockey puck" of a bird got the best of him...he'll never forget it! :21:
